Optional application of orientation for TIFF
Make the image orientation only optionally applied for TIFF images to match the new image handler flags. The default however remains to apply transformation, as opposed to JPEGs. The patch also adds the capability to write metadata orientation. Change-Id: Ie24664516138641342ab6d7559d591f38b9f1e8a Reviewed-by: Gunnar Sletta <gunnar@sletta.org>
